For anyone looking to lose weight healthily and sustainably, Mike explained: “You need to eat and drink fewer calories than you burn. 

“If you take in more calories than you burn, you won’t lose weight. 

“Whilst people may try many types of diet, if a person loses weight on any diet, they will – whether they realise it or not – have taken in fewer calories than they have burnt. 

“A person can create a calorie deficit by reducing the number of calories they eat, increasing their activity levels, or both.
